Trump Administration Withholds $1 Billion For Renewables Research

Among the majority of western nations fulfilling their civic duty in concern with anthropogenic climate change, the Trump administration’s Department of Energy (DOE) has held back nearly $1 billion in funds that were set aside for Clean Energy Research and Development Program.

This was reported at a congressional Democrats hearing on Wednesday. Bill Foster a Democratic Representative of Illinois, said $823 million in funding that was appropriated by Congress was not spent by the DOE’s Office of Energy Efficiency and Renewable Energy (EERE).

Foster who is chairman of the panel’s Investigations and Oversight subcommittee, goes on to say:

When Congress passes a budget, we expect that budget to be followed. It’s unclear to many of us there has been a completely good-faith effort.

Those funds were to provide grants and go towards research to boost renewable energy, electric vehicles, and energy efficiency. The EERE also canceled a $46 million program that was meant to fund solar research and development.

Arjun Krishnaswami, the Natural Resources Defense Council’s Climate and Clean Energy Program analyst, left a testimony:

The magnitude of carryover funds is an indication of whether DOE is following congressional guidance and spending appropriated funds in a timely manner—and more carryover funds means less money from prior years is getting to clean energy innovators to do their work. The agency is flouting congressional intent.

Daniel Simmons, a Trump-appointed EERE assistant secretary, claims the department “fully intends to utilize its appropriated research funding.” However, Simmons is a known critic of renewable research and development. He has openly criticized federal support of wind power and went on to claim wind power is hurting farmers, despite paying the landowners nearly $222 million per year.

Simmons has also openly bashed solar projects as well, not surprising from the long time Koch affiliate. Charles Koch, having served as a member of President Carter’s energy task force, has actively fought against the entire concept of the US DOE for decades, as far back as 1977. Simmons was previously vice president for policy at the American Energy Alliance and Institute of Energy Research (IER), both of which are Koch-funded groups.

The Trump administration has been proposing to cut the EERE’s budget for years. Last year they tried to cut the EERE’s office spending by 86%, but Congress ignored that request. In 2018 Trump proposed to cut the Department of Energy by $1.6 billion and the EERE’s budget by 70% or $1.4 billion.

The administration also replaced the Clean Power Plan, allowing CO2 emitting coal plants to remain open longer, removed emissions standards for power plants and scaled back auto emissions standards.

This is also the same administration that pushes for logging in Alaska’s Tongass National Forest, in what Trump calls a personal interest in “forest management.” Trump also issued an executive order to expand logging practices on public lands because it will curb wildfires.
